Statistik til hjemmesiden

Har du en hjemmeside og ønsker at vide hvor mange besøgende og hvilke sider der besøges har du brug for et værktøj der kan oplyse dig dette. Mest kendt er nok Google Analytics(GA).

GA har dog den alvorligte ulempe at dine besøgendes data deles automatisk med Google og kan misbruges til markedsføringsformål og profilering af de besøgende. Da du deler dine besøgendes data med tredje-part skal du de besøgendes samtykke og risikerer store bøder hvis du ikke overholder dette.

Primitive analytics in english

Pga. datadelingen fravælges GA af rigtig mange. Jeg har f.eks. brugt Matomo til at holde tal med besøgende gennem årene brugt Matomo, som er et gratis og open source værktøj, du kan installere på egen hjemmesider. Ulempen ved både Matomo og de fleste alternative værktøjer til webstatisk er at de kræver en regulær database. Typisk er det Postgres eller MySQL/MariaDB for at kunne fungere.

Jeg skiftet webhotel udbyder fra DigitalOcen til Hetzner og besluttede at droppe Matomo og bruge et alternativt værktøj da det er meget primitiv statisktik jeg har brug for. Jeg har brug for antal besøgende pr. dag, hvilke sider er mest besøgte og evt hvordan de besøgende havner på hjemmesiden.

Da jeg også ønsker at undgå cookie og GDPR notifikationer kræver det at et værktøj ikke må anvende cookies og ikke registrere personhenførbare oplysninger (PII - Personally identifiable information)

Mulige alternativer til Google Analytics og Matomo

Følgende scripts påstår at tage hensyn til de besøgendes anonymitet og var mine kandidater.

En håndfuld andre blev også overvejet, men ovenstående er de mest interessante.

De udvidede krav -
1) Ingen personhenførbar data registreres eller deles.
2) Ingen irriterende GDPR og cookie notifikationer.
3) Skal kunne anvendes på simple html sider.
4) Scriptet skal være i PHP da det er det mest udbredte scriptsprog.
5) Hjemmesideejeren ejer al data 6) Yderligere server processer skal ikke være nødvendige.

Ingen alternative valgt

Punkterne 3, 4 og 6 kunne ikke opfyldes af disse scripts. Alle scripts kræver omfattende IT viden, databaseservere, en serverproces til at læse data osv. Intet af det er er noget en almindelig hjemmeside ejer kan udføre. Alle skripts er der uegnet for almindelige brugere.

Løsningen blev at oprette et script selv!

Primitiv webstatistik

Scriptet baseres på at der smides et kort, simpelt og overskueligt stykke javascript på hjemmesiden, der indsamler forskellige oplysninger fra browseren. I praksis sker det ved at der hentes et usynligt 1px billede. Vigtigste er egentlig blot skærmens bredde, om det er en mobil enhed og hvor den besøgende kommer fra (referer). Der indsamles også andre oplysninger enten via javascript eller via PHP script på server. Dette er nok til lave brugbar information om f.eks.

- Antal besøgende pr. periode (dag, uge, måned,...)
- Hvor de besøgende kommer fra
- Hvilke sider besøges af hvor mange
- Hvilke enheder (computer, telefoner, tablets) benytter de besøgende.

Kontakt

Email: [email protected]